Spotsylvania County, Virginia

Spotsylvania County is right in the middle of Virginia, about halfway between Washington D.C. and Richmond. The county has seen its fair share of action. Four major Civil War battles were fought here.
But don’t think it’s stuck in the past. Spotsylvania is growing fast, with new neighborhoods popping up all over. The county seat, Spotsylvania Courthouse, is tiny but packed with history. You can’t miss the cannons on the courthouse lawn.
Lake Anna is a big draw, perfect for boating and fishing. There’s plenty of shopping and dining options in the more built-up areas. And if you’re into wine, you’re in luck. There are several vineyards in the county. It’s a place that manages to keep one foot in the past and one in the future.
Category | Details |
---|---|
County Name | Spotsylvania County |
County Seat | Spotsylvania Courthouse |
Population | Approximately 148,000 |
Cities, Towns, and Communities | Fredericksburg (independent city but county offices are here), Spotsylvania Courthouse, Massaponax, Chancellor, Partlow |
Interstates and Highways | I-95, US-1, US-17, VA-3 |
FIPS Code | 51-177 |
Total Area (Land and Water) | 414 sq mi (Land: 401 sq mi; Water: 13 sq mi) |
Adjacent Counties (and Direction) | Culpeper County (North), Stafford County (Northeast), Fredericksburg City (Northeast), Caroline County (Southeast), Hanover County (South), Louisa County (Southwest), Orange County (West) |
Time Zone | Eastern Time Zone (ET) |
State | Virginia |
Coordinates | 38.2041° N, 77.5843° W |
Etymology | Named after Alexander Spotswood, Lieutenant Governor of Virginia |
Major Landmarks | Fredericksburg and Spotsylvania National Military Park, Lake Anna State Park, Chancellorsville Battlefield |
